Increasing the Competitiveness of Small and Medium-Sized Enterprises (SMEs) through Tourism Measures (Tourism Funding Guideline)

Grant for the development and modernization of tourist infrastructures in Lower Saxony to strengthen the competitiveness of SMEs. Funding up to €3 million, applications possible at any time before project commencement.

Grant criteria

Application Deadline: Ongoing
Application level: Advanced
Region: Lower Saxony
Company size: SME
Funding amount: max. €3,000,000
Funding rate: 40% - 75%

Funding objective

Promotion of tourism investments and measures to increase attractiveness and visitor numbers in regions of Lower Saxony, in order to enhance the competitiveness of local small and medium-sized enterprises.

Eligible expenses

  • New construction or expansion of tourist infrastructure of supraregional importance
  • Barrier-free tourist services
  • Digital services in publicly accessible facilities
  • Sustainable and climate-compatible measures

Eligible to apply

  • Public Institutions
  • Non-profit Organizations

Funding requirements

  • Implementation of the project in the eligible program area (SER or ÜR)
  • Proof of a regional tourism concept
  • More than 50% tourist use of the funded infrastructure
  • Overall cost financing secured
  • Compliance with quality criteria and exclusion of other funding bases for digital and sustainable offerings

Documents required for application

  1. Electronic application via the NBank customer portal
  2. Project description
  3. Financing plan
  4. Regional tourism concept
  5. De minimis declaration
  6. Declaration on the EU Charter of Fundamental Rights

Evaluation criteria

  • Integration into the regional tourism concept
  • Innovation and sustainability aspects
  • Contribution to the competitiveness of SMEs

Description

The tourism funding guideline of the State of Lower Saxony aims to enhance the competitiveness of local small and medium-sized enterprises through targeted investments in tourism infrastructure. Municipal authorities as well as legal entities under public and private law, including non-profit limited liability companies, foundations, or registered associations, can apply for one-time grants of up to €3 million. Projects for the new construction or modernization of infrastructure of supra-regional significance, barrier-free offerings, digital applications, as well as sustainable and climate-compatible measures are supported. The funding rates range between 40% and 75% of eligible expenses depending on the program area, with combined use of ERDF, GRW, and state funds possible. Applications can be submitted at any time before the project start and are processed by the Investment and Development Bank of Lower Saxony (NBank).

A prerequisite for approval is proof of a regional tourism concept, tourist use of more than 50% of the funded infrastructure, and secured overall financing of the project. Additionally, quality criteria must be met and alternative funding bases for digital or sustainable measures must be excluded. Eligible expenses include the new construction or expansion of infrastructure of supra-regional importance, barrier-free and digital offerings in publicly accessible facilities, as well as climate-friendly measures. For the application, among other documents, a project description, a financing plan, the de minimis declaration, and a declaration regarding the EU Charter of Fundamental Rights are required.
